What seem to be emerging as one of the best soundcards on the market is the RME Hammerfall. Its an ASIO card, so I'm not sure if it will work with Vegas, but it has wordclock, and the in/outs are Adat lightpipes. They then sell a range of very high quality AD DA converters. These offer SPIDF in out's and Adat in outs and tdif as well as analogue in/outs. The cards start from about £230 and the AD/DA converters are about £800 upwards. Not dirt cheap, but for a professional product they are definitely not expensive, and outperform units costing 4 times their price. (Better sound to my ears than Pro-Tools) lol.Regards
